Suffrage: 21 years of age; universal
Executive branch: King MOHAMED VI (since 23 July 1999) head of
government: Council of Ministers appointed by the monarch elections:
none; the monarch is hereditary; prime minister appointed by the monarch
following legislative elections
Legislative branch: bicameral Parliament consists of an upper house or
Chamber of Counselors (270 seats; members elected indirectly by local
councils, professional organizations, and labor syndicates for nine-year
terms; one-third of the members are renewed every three years) and a lower
house or Chamber of Representatives (325 seats; members elected by popular
vote for five-year terms) elections: Chamber of Counselors - last held 15
September 2000 (next to be held NA 2002); Chamber of Representatives -
last held 14 November 1997 (next to be held NA November 2002) election
results: Chamber of Counselors - percent of vote by party - NA%; seats
by party - NA; Chamber of Representatives - percent of vote by party -
NA%; seats by party - USFP 57, UC 50, RNI 46, MP 40, MDS 32, IP 32,
MNP 19, PND 10, MPCD 9, PPS 9, FFD 9, PSD 5, OADP 4, PA 2, PDI 1
Judicial branch: Supreme Court (judges are appointed on the
recommendation of the Supreme Council of the Judiciary, presided over
by the monarch)
